理解Java内存:数据存放与类型管理
需积分: 28 145 浏览量
更新于2024-07-13
收藏 1.52MB PPT 举报
在"内存如何存放数据 - 使用Java理解程序逻辑第二章"中,本章节深入探讨了计算机内存的工作原理以及在Java编程中的应用。首先,章节明确了内存作为计算机中临时存储计算所需数据的关键组件,将其比喻为旅馆,形象地阐述了数据存储的过程。在Java中,数据存储涉及以下几个关键知识点:
1. **变量与数据类型**:变量是程序中的临时存储单元,用来存储数据。Java支持多种数据类型,如基本数据类型(如int, double, boolean等)和引用数据类型(如String)。每种类型都有其特定的内存大小和特性。
2. **运算符**:包括赋值运算符(=)、算术运算符(如+、-、*、/、%),这些运算符用于操作数据并改变变量的值。
3. **代码结构**:例如,纠正了一个简单的Java程序示例,展示了如何使用`public class Test`声明类,`main()`方法作为程序入口,并使用`System.out.println`输出文本。
4. **注释**:介绍了Java中的两种注释类型:单行注释(//)和多行注释(/*...*/),这对于文档编写和代码维护非常重要。
5. **开发步骤**:包括使用Eclipse这样的集成开发环境(IDE)开发Java程序,涉及到代码编辑、编译和运行。
6. **内存地址与变量查找**:虽然内存地址通常难以记住,但在Java中,通过变量名就可以找到相应数据的存储位置,这是因为每个变量都有一个唯一的标识符。
7. **数据类型转换**:理解何时会发生自动类型转换(如当不同类型的数值相加时),以及如何进行强制类型转换,确保数据的正确处理。
8. **实际应用**:涉及了实际编程任务,如计算成绩差、平均分,升级购物管理系统,模拟抽奖,以及计算员工工资等,这些都要求掌握变量的使用、数据类型、运算以及用户输入处理。
9. **目标与任务**:本章的目标是使读者掌握变量的概念,熟练使用数据类型,了解运算符,以及进行数据类型转换。具体任务包括实现基础运算功能和升级特定系统功能。
通过这一系列知识点的学习,读者将能更好地理解Java程序中内存如何存储和管理不同类型的数据,从而更有效地编写和调试代码。
2019-03-19 上传
2020-04-20 上传
2014-05-07 上传
2023-05-19 上传
2023-03-16 上传
2023-04-03 上传
2023-04-29 上传
2023-06-03 上传
2023-12-05 上传
theAIS
- 粉丝: 52
- 资源: 2万+
最新资源
- zlib-1.2.12压缩包解析与技术要点
- 微信小程序滑动选项卡源码模版发布
- Unity虚拟人物唇同步插件Oculus Lipsync介绍
- Nginx 1.18.0版本WinSW自动安装与管理指南
- Java Swing和JDBC实现的ATM系统源码解析
- 掌握Spark Streaming与Maven集成的分布式大数据处理
- 深入学习推荐系统:教程、案例与项目实践
- Web开发者必备的取色工具软件介绍
- C语言实现李春葆数据结构实验程序
- 超市管理系统开发:asp+SQL Server 2005实战
- Redis伪集群搭建教程与实践
- 掌握网络活动细节:Wireshark v3.6.3网络嗅探工具详解
- 全面掌握美赛:建模、分析与编程实现教程
- Java图书馆系统完整项目源码及SQL文件解析
- PCtoLCD2002软件:高效图片和字符取模转换
- Java开发的体育赛事在线购票系统源码分析